## Weekend Lift Works — Reception Guidance

Reception staff at Amberfold House: both lifts are offline Saturday for servicing by Crake & Sons. Direct visitors to the west stairs and offer assistance to anyone with mobility needs. Engineers must sign in on arrival. To admit them through the plant-room door, use the code below.

door code, yagap-bahof: bdg-O-05

Plugin authors triggering incremental rebuilds should note that the build daemon diffs the content graph before scheduling page regeneration; touching shared layouts invalidates every dependent route, so batch layout changes carefully. Rebuild requests are idempotent within a five-minute window, and duplicate submissions are coalesced. If a rebuild stalls, inspect the daemon's journal before retrying. All rebuild API calls must be signed, so your env file needs the signing credential on the following line:

env line for fafof-fahag: LEDGER_TOKEN5=f8790

Subject: Quickstore 4.2 — bloom filter now fronts the KV layer

Plugin authors: starting with this release, Quickstore places a bloom filter ahead of the key-value store. Negative lookups return faster; false positives fall through safely. No API changes are required on your side. Verify your plugin against the staging build referenced below.

session token of fahif-tadup = htk3_9c7

Ticket: Staging env misconfigured for Siftgate bloom filter

The bloom layer in front of the Pellet KV store is rejecting all lookups in staging because the env file was copied from the dev template without credentials. False-positive tuning values are fine; only the auth line is missing. To unblock the weekly demo, the Pellet admission secret must be set on the following line.

env line for yaguf-fajop: LEDGER_TOKEN13=fb08984397349

TURN-208: Gatevale turnstile counters at the Merrow Field pilot double-count when a rotation reverses mid-cycle. Attendance totals drift roughly 2% high per event. The debounce window fix is implemented, reviewed by Ilsa, and soak-tested across two simulated match days without drift. Ready for your cut; the candidate build is identified below.

trace token, tagag-tafog: htk6_5ed18c